    Why Proper Disposal of Dead Car Batteries is Important

    When it comes to proper disposal of dead car batteries, it’s essential for the well-being of the environment and communities. Here’s why it matters:

    • Toxic Materials: Dead car batteries contain harmful chemicals like lead and sulfuric acid.
    • Pollution Prevention: Recycling dead car batteries reduces the risk of soil and water contamination.
    • Resource Conservation: Reusing materials from old batteries decreases the need for new resources.
    • Legal Compliance: Disposing of car batteries improperly can lead to fines or penalties.

    The next time you’re faced with a dead car battery, remember the impact of responsible disposal methods.

    Where Not to Dispose Dead Car Batteries

    When it comes to dead car batteries, knowing where not to dispose of them is just as crucial as understanding the right disposal options. Improper disposal can have severe consequences for the environment and human health. Here are some places to avoid when getting rid of dead car batteries:

    • Household Waste: Tossing dead car batteries in your regular trash bin is a big no-no. These batteries contain toxic materials, such as lead and sulfuric acid, that can leak into the environment when left in landfills.
    • Burning: Avoid burning dead car batteries at all costs. Toxic fumes released during the burning process can contaminate the air and pose significant health risks.
    • Dumping in Nature: Never dispose of dead car batteries in nature, such as forests, rivers, or parks. This can lead to pollution of water sources and harm wildlife.

    How to Safely Transport Dead Car Batteries

    When it comes to transporting dead car batteries for disposal, it’s important to handle them with care to prevent leaks and potential harm to yourself and the environment. Here are some tips to help you safely transport dead car batteries:

    • Handle with Care: Wear protective gloves when handling dead car batteries to avoid any contact with the potentially harmful substances inside.
    • Secure Packaging: Place the dead car battery in a leak-proof container to prevent any acid leaks during transport.
    • Avoid Tipping: Ensure the battery remains upright during transport to prevent spills or leaks.
    • Secure Placement: Place the battery in a stable position in your vehicle to prevent it from moving around during transportation.
    • Proper Ventilation: If transporting the battery inside your vehicle, ensure there is adequate ventilation to disperse any fumes that may be emitted.
    • Professional Assistance: If unsure about how to safely transport a dead car battery, consider seeking help from a professional or a local waste management facility.

    Remember, safely transporting dead car batteries is crucial to prevent spills, leaks, and exposure to harmful substances. By following these tips, you can ensure the safe disposal of dead car batteries while minimizing risks to yourself and the environment.

    Recycling Centers for Dead Car Batteries

    When it’s time to dispose of your dead car battery, recycling centers are your best bet. Here’s what you need to know:

    • Why recycle: Dead car batteries contain harmful substances that can leach into the environment if not disposed of properly.
    • Find a center: Look for local recycling centers or auto shops that accept dead car batteries for proper disposal.
    • Requirements: Some centers may have specific drop-off hours or collection procedures, so it’s best to call ahead.
    • Transport safely: Remember to follow the safety tips mentioned earlier while transporting the battery to the recycling center.
    StatisticValue
    Number of car batteries recycled annually in the US99 million
    Recycling rate of car batteries in the US99%
    Percentage of lead in a typical car battery that can be recycled98%

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Why is it important to safely transport dead car batteries?

    Safely transporting dead car batteries is crucial to prevent leaks of harmful substances like lead and sulfuric acid, which can harm individuals and the environment.

    How can dead car batteries be safely handled?

    Dead car batteries should be stored upright in a secure container to prevent spills, leaks, or damage to the terminals. Wear gloves and eye protection when handling them to avoid exposure to hazardous materials.

    Why is recycling dead car batteries important?

    Recycling dead car batteries helps prevent environmental contamination by safely extracting and reusing valuable materials like lead, plastic, and acid, reducing the need for new raw materials and minimizing waste.

    How can one find local centers for dead car battery disposal?

    Search for local recycling centers, auto shops, or service stations that accept dead car batteries for recycling. Contact them to inquire about drop-off requirements and any fees associated with disposal.

    What are some safety tips for transporting dead car batteries?

    When transporting dead car batteries, secure them in an upright position in a leak-proof container. Avoid tipping or dropping the batteries, and ensure proper ventilation in the transport vehicle to prevent exposure to fumes.
